Alfonsina Eyang
Alfonsina Eyang is an entrepreneur and cosmetics founder from Equatorial Guinea, known as the founder and chief executive officer of the skincare brand EwomanSkin. She is associated with the international expansion of independent dermocosmetic brands originating from African entrepreneurs and has been recognized in several European entrepreneurship and business award programs.
Her work is primarily focused on developing skincare products addressing hyperpigmentation and skin tone irregularities, while positioning her brand in the dermocosmetic segment of the beauty industry.

Career
Eyang began her entrepreneurial journey at approximately 17 years old, initially operating a business focused on hair extensions and beauty-related retail products. This early venture introduced her to product sourcing, customer engagement, and digital marketing strategies in the beauty sector.
Building on this experience, she later founded EwomanSkin, a dermocosmetic skincare brand designed to address concerns such as hyperpigmentation, dark spots, uneven skin tone, and skin blemishes. The brand positions itself within the dermocosmetic category, combining cosmetic skincare with dermatological-oriented product positioning.
EwomanSkin’s product range focuses on skincare formulations intended for daily treatment and maintenance, with a marketing emphasis on accessibility and compatibility with diverse skin types. Under Eyang’s leadership, the brand expanded its reach beyond Spain into a number of international markets.
Reports about the brand indicate that its products have reached customers in Romania, Iceland, the United States, and several markets across Asia and Africa, reflecting a distribution strategy that combines online commerce with international retail partnerships.

Recognition
Eyang and her company have received recognition within various entrepreneurship and business award programs in Europe. Products from the EwomanSkin brand have been recognized in consumer-tested beauty awards in Spain, reflecting market visibility within the competitive cosmetics industry.
She has also been included in “Under 30” entrepreneurial recognition programs, highlighting young business founders who have built companies at an early stage in their careers.
In 2025, Eyang was reported to have been named a finalist in the Best CEO Awards Europe, a business award program recognizing leadership in corporate and entrepreneurial organizations. The recognition was notable as she was described in coverage as one of the few entrepreneurs from Equatorial Guinea to appear in that category.
